Steubenville Country Club is a private 18-hole golf course located in Steubenville, Ohio. Established in 1923, the course features bent grass greens and winter rye grass fairways. Designed by Ferdinand Garbin in 1970, the club offers golfers a comprehensive practice environment with a dedicated driving range and teaching professional on-site. The course provides members with a traditional golf experience in the Ohio landscape. Facilities include a driving range where players can refine their skills under professional guidance. As a private club, Steubenville Country Club maintains an exclusive membership approach to its golf operations.
